    Waterford finance board approves new tax rate

    Waterford — The Board of Finance last week approved a tax rate of 25.83 mills for the 2015-16 fiscal year by a vote of 4-1, with Norman Glidden voting against it. The rate shows a roughly 4 percent increase over the current tax rate, despite a decrease in the approved budget.

    The Representative Town Meeting last week approved a general fund budget of $86.3 million for the 2015-16 fiscal year. The budget shows a decrease of 0.7 percent compared to the current budget.

    Finance Director Maryanna Stevens said the increase in the tax rate resulted from a roughly $2 million decreas in revenues in 2014-15 and 1.22 percent decrease — equivalent to about $39 million — in the 2014 grand list.

    The revenue decrease she attributed to the expiration of one-time capital grants, accounting for about two-thirds of the 1.03 mill increase in the tax rate. She said depreciation of personal property values at Millstone Power Station caused the bulk of the drop in the grand list, accounting for the other third of the increase.
